Quranic Sciences International Board to Be Set Up in Egypt

13:35 - May 17, 2013
News ID: 2534497
Head of the Holy Quran Revision Committee in Al-Azhar University announced that an International Board of Quranic Sciences will be established in Egypt.
According to Al-Yawm Al-Sabe’ newspaper, Sheikh Isaa Al-Ma’sarawi, the Sheikh (master) of Egyptian Qaris and head of the committee said that Egypt is a country where Quranic sciences have developed among Arab and Islamic countries and a school in which eminent Quran reciters of the world of Islam are trained.
Speaking at a meeting with Mustafa Isaa, governor of Al-Minya Province in Egypt, Al-Ma’sarawi announced that the International Board of Quranic Sciences will be established in the country.
Various stages of setting up a center for Quranic studies in the province were also discussed at the meeting.
The governor of of Al-Minya Province said that the project is underway with the cooperation and supervision of a large number of experts and intellectuals.
He added that the center aims to facilitate teaching of the Holy Quran to the students of the region and noted that other educational centers and the private universities of the province will also be supported and granted services to realize the objective.
